University of Wyoming majors

University of Wyoming has granted 1,931 bachelor's degrees across 94 programs, 553 master's across 50 programs, and 234 doctorate degrees across 27 programs. Below is a table with majors that lead to degrees at University of Wyoming.

Publications & Citations

University of Wyoming is a world-class research university with 38,196 scientific papers published and 1,210,428 citations received. The research profile covers a range of fields, including Biology, Environmental Science, Engineering, Chemistry, Liberal Arts & Social Sciences, Physics, Geology, Computer Science, Geography and Cartography, and Ecology.

Scott Usher

2. Scott Usher

1983-. (aged 43)
swimmer
Scott Usher is an American former competition swimmer who represented the United States at the 2004 Summer Olympics in Athens, Greece. He swam for Grand Island Senior High. He then swam for years at the University of Wyoming under the direction of head coach, Thomas Johnson.
